The use of sugar cane bagasse ash is being studied for application in the constructionrnindustry because of its technical, economic and to a large extent, environmentalrnadvantages. This study has investigated the improvement of early strength development ofrnconcrete containing bagasse ash by addition of chemical activator. rnbagasse replacement is done 10%, 20% and 30% by volume of cement and casted withrnand without activator. rnThe compressive strength properties of bagasse ash blended cement paste, mortar andrnconcrete with and without activator were studied. The results indicate that bagasse ashrnblended concrete gives higher strength when activated with sodium sulfate. rnX- ray diffraction test also held on bagasse ash blended cement paste casted and cured forrn7days and 28 days. The result verified the strength improvement is due to increasing thernbagasse pozzolanic activity.
